Advies voor het implementeren van geavanceerde gebruikersbeheer in TYPO3
description
Met deze prompt krijg je specifiek advies over het opzetten van een veilig en efficiënt gebruikersbeheer in TYPO3. Het helpt problemen met toegangscontrole en rechtenbeheer op te lossen, waardoor je website beter beschermd en overzichtelijker wordt dan met standaardinstellingen.
prompt
Help me een geavanceerd gebruikersbeheer systeem op te zetten in TYPO3. Beschrijf mijn huidige gebruikersstructuur: <beschrijf je huidige gebruikersstructu ...
try_prompt
generate_helper
disclaimerOnPageApi
tags
ai_answers
provider: openai
model: gpt-4.1-nano
Natuurlijk! Hier is een stapsgewijze aanpak om een geavanceerd gebruikersbeheersysteem op te zetten in TYPO3 11.5, afgestemd op jouw situatie:
1. **Gebruikers en Groepen aanmaken**
- Ga naar **Admin Tools > Backend Users** en maak gebruikersaccounts aan voor de 3 content editors en 1 sitebeheerder.
- Organiseer gebruikers in groepen: bijvoorbeeld één groep voor editors en één voor de sitebeheerder.
2. **Groepen en Toegangsrechten instellen**
- Ga naar **Access Lists** of **Backend User Groups**.
- Voor de content editors:
- Geef deze groep enkel rechten om pagina's te bewerken.
- Beperk hun toegang tot alleen de pagina's die ze mogen aanpassen (bijvoorbeeld door pagina- en recordrechten in te stellen).
- Voor de sitebeheerder:
- Geef volledige beheersrechten, inclusief extensiebeheer en systeeminstellingen.
3. **Pagina- en Recordrechten configureren**
- Stel bij elke pagina de juiste toegangsrechten in via de **Page Properties > Access**.
- Gebruik de **Page Access Rights** om te bepalen wie de pagina kan lezen, bewerken of beheren.
- Zorg dat editors geen rechten krijgen op extensiebeheertools of systeeminstellingen.
4. **Rolgebaseerde Toegangscontrole (RBAC)** (optioneel, voor meer verfijning)
- Overweeg het gebruik van extensies zoals **"felogin"** of **"frontend_user"** voor meer gedetailleerde gebruikersrollen.
- Voor jouw doel is het meestal voldoende om de standaard rechten en groepen te gebruiken.
5. **Beperkingen voor editors**
- Zorg dat de editors geen rechten hebben op het beheer van extensies door hun rechten op systeem- en installatiemodules uit te schakelen.
- Dit doe je door hun rechten in te stellen onder **Backend User Group > Modules** en **Access Lists**.
6. **Testen en verfijnen**
- Log in als een editor en controleer of ze alleen pagina's kunnen bewerken.
- Log in als de sitebeheerder en controleer volledige toegang.
7. **Documentatie en procedures**
- Leg duidelijk vast welke rechten elke gebruiker heeft en hoe ze moeten werken.
- Zorg voor documentatie over het toevoegen van nieuwe gebruikers en het beheren van rechten.
**Samenvatting:**
Gebruik gebruikersgroepen om editors en beheerders te onderscheiden, stel pagina- en recordrechten in voor de editors zodat ze alleen pagina's kunnen aanpassen, en beperk hun toegang tot systeem- en extensiebeheer door de juiste modules en rechten uit te schakelen. Hiermee creëer je een overzichtelijk en veilig gebruikersbeheer in TYPO3 11.5 dat aan jouw eisen voldoet.
provider: deepseek
model: deepseek-chat
Hallo! Ik help je graag met het opzetten van een geavanceerd gebruikersbeheersysteem in TYPO3 11.5. Hier is een stapsgewijze handleiding op basis van je huidige structuur:
## 1. Gebruikersgroepen aanmaken
**Backend gebruikersgroepen:**
- `Content Editors` (voor de 3 editors)
- `Site Administrator` (voor de beheerder)
## 2. Gebruikersrechten configureren
**Voor Content Editors groep:**
- Alleen toegang tot pagina's module
- Alleen rechten voor pagina's bewerken (geen verwijderen/aanmaken)
- Geen toegang tot extensies, systeeminstellingen of backend gebruikersbeheer
**Voor Site Administrator:**
- Volledige toegang tot alle modules
- Beheerrechten voor extensies en systeeminstellingen
- Gebruikersbeheerrechten
## 3. Gedetailleerde configuratiestappen
**In de Backend:**
1. Ga naar **BEHEREN → Gebruikers → Gebruikersgroepen**
2. Maak nieuwe groep `Content Editors` aan
3. Stel onder **Toegangsrechten** in:
- Alleen `Paginastructuur` module toegestaan
- Onder **Tabelrechten**: alleen `paginas` met `bewerken` rechten
- Onder **Pagina-rechten**: selecteer alleen de gewenste paginabomen
4. Maak groep `Site Administrator` aan met volledige rechten
## 4. Gebruikers aanmaken
1. Ga naar **BEHEREN → Gebruikers → Backend gebruikers**
2. Maak 3 gebruikers aan en wijs ze toe aan `Content Editors` groep
3. Maak 1 gebruiker aan en wijs toe aan `Site Administrator` groep
## 5. Geavanceerde beveiliging
**Via TSconfig:**
```typoscript
# Voor Content Editors:
options.pageTree.doktypes = 1
options.hideModules = web,file,user,tools,system
```
## 6. Aanvullende beveiliging
- Stel wachtwoordbeleid in via **Instellingen → Beveiliging & Privacy**
- Configureer sessiebeheer en loginbeveiliging
- Overweeg tweefactorauthenticatie voor de site beheerder
## 7. Monitoring
- Log alle gebruikersactiviteiten via sys_log
- Stel emailnotificaties in voor belangrijke wijzigingen
Heb je specifieke vragen over een van deze stappen of wil je bepaalde aspecten verder uitwerken?